@artaxerxe overall idea is to not do the OSGi handling in "main" code but keep it located in OSGi package if possible (not a huge requirement but would be saner overall for the project). One constraint is to be able to run without OSGi in all env, including security manager/javaagent ones and having an indirection makes it easier to guarantee but otherwise looks ok to me. |
